The author argues that the real problem is not just detecting AI output, but detecting "slop" — low-quality, fake, or careless content.

Quoted context says not all slop is AI and not all AI use is slop. The point is that some people use AI carefully to do real work, and they are also worried about slop because fake output can crowd out genuine work. The post reframes the debate from "AI detectors" to "slop detectors."
